Aerial photography begins with a decision the ground never asks for: which of the two altitudes of seeing the frame belongs to. Straight down, the nadir view, deletes the horizon and with it every habit of landscape seeing. The world stops being scenery and becomes surface: fields turn to color blocks, roads to drawn lines, a coastline to a torn edge. It is the genre's most distinctive gift and its most demanding one, because with no horizon and no sky, the frame has nothing to lean on but graphic design: pattern, rhythm, division, the geometry that only exists from above. Tilt the camera forward into the oblique view and the world comes partway back: depth returns, the horizon returns, scale reads naturally again (a landscape photograph made from a tripod no hill could offer). Neither view is superior. The failure is drifting between them: a frame tilted a little down and a little forward, half map and half landscape, committing to neither. Decide which photograph this is before the shutter, and compose to that view's rules.
The second discipline is light, and altitude makes it stricter, not looser. From above, the terrain has almost no depth cues left except shadow, and shadow is manufactured entirely by sun angle. Low sun rakes across the ground and carves it: every dune ridge, furrow, treeline, and rooftop throws a shadow that gives the surface relief, and in a top-down frame those long shadows often are the subject (a row of trees at sunrise reads as a row of dark exclamation marks laid across gold). The same terrain under a high midday sun goes flat, a shadowless plane where texture dies and the frame has to survive on color alone. A few scenes want that flatness (turquoise shallows, graphic color fields) but they are the exceptions that prove the rule. The working default for terrain, texture, and form is the first and last hours of usable light, exactly when the ground-level photographers are out too, and for the same reason.
The third discipline is scale, because the top-down view quietly abolishes it. With no horizon and no familiar vanishing-point perspective, a frame of ridgelines could be a mountain range or a sand ripple: the viewer has no way to know. That ambiguity is a tool with two honest settings. Embrace it fully and the frame becomes abstraction, judged purely as design. Or anchor it deliberately: one boat on the water, one car on the ribbon of road, a single walker and their long shadow (an object of known size that snaps the whole frame into scale and, usually, becomes its focal point in the same stroke). What reads as neither (a vast pattern with a stray, unconsidered scale-giver cluttering one corner) is the frame that chose nothing. Altitude itself is the same kind of choice: lower and the frame is intimate, individual trees and textures; higher and it is pattern and geography. Height is the aerial photographer's focal length. Pick it for what the composition needs, not for how far the aircraft can climb.

The flight is the shoot, and it is bounded on every side. A battery buys minutes aloft, not hours; the low sun that carves the terrain is itself moving; and wind that is a breeze on the ground can be weather at altitude, costing stability, battery, and eventually the flight itself. So the craft starts before takeoff: scout the location on the map, know the two or three compositions the site offers and the sun angle each one wants, and launch with a plan, because a flight spent searching is a flight spent, and the raking light does not wait for the search to finish.
When the frame is found, stop. Bring the aircraft to a full hover, let the gimbal settle, and shoot from stillness; frames grabbed on the move, in wind, from a platform still translating, pay for the impatience in fine detail.
Part of the plan is the part that never appears in the frame: fly legally and considerately. The specific rules differ by country and change over time (registration, airspace permissions, distances from people, airports, and protected sites) so the discipline is not a number to memorize but a habit to keep: know the current local rules before the flight, keep the aircraft where it is permitted and in sight, and respect the privacy of the people below, who did not agree to be in the photograph. A frame that required breaking any of that is not a frame the genre counts.
Exposure discipline is where the sensor makes its terms known. Most camera drones carry a small sensor, and a small sensor holds less dynamic range and less high-ISO tolerance than the ground-level cameras that may share the bag, which is not a defect to lament but a condition to shoot inside. The consequences are concrete. Stay at or near base ISO whenever the light allows; the shadows of a small-sensor file do not take a hard lift gracefully. Protect the highlights (sunlit water, white rooftops, the bright sky in an oblique) because a clipped highlight is gone, while a slightly dark midtone is negotiable.
When the scene spans more range than the sensor holds (a low sun in an oblique frame is the classic case), bracket exposures from the hover and merge later; a stationary aircraft and a static landscape make bracketing nearly free. And keep the shutter honestly fast for stills: the platform is never perfectly still, and a shutter chosen as if the camera were on a tripod hands the wind the fine detail. All of this is the same sentence folded four ways: a small sensor rewards being flown in good light, and punishes the flight that treats light as post-production's problem.
Sharpness has one more term worth knowing. Many drone cameras carry a fixed aperture, and on those the exposure conversation is only shutter and ISO. Where the aperture does adjust, small sensors reach diffraction early, stopping far down begins to soften the whole frame rather than sharpen it, and depth of field is rarely the reason to try: at aerial distances, focus is effectively at infinity and everything from the treetops to the horizon sits in the same plane of sharpness.
Keep the aperture in the lens's comfortable middle, focus deliberately rather than trusting whatever the autofocus grabbed on the way up, and check sharpness at magnification on the first frame of the flight, not the last.

Aerial files earn their edit in three familiar places. The first is the horizon: in an oblique frame, a tilt of even a degree reads instantly, because the horizon is a straight line against the frame edge with nothing to hide behind (level it first, before any other judgment is made). The second is haze. There is more atmosphere between an aerial camera and its subject than a ground-level frame ever deals with, and it arrives as lifted blacks, muted color, and a veil over distant detail; a measured touch of dehaze and contrast restores the scene the air diluted. Measured is the operative word: pushed hard, dehaze turns skies dirty and edges electric, and the frame starts to look processed before it looks better. The third is the small-sensor file itself: noise reduction applied selectively (smooth the sky and the flat tones, protect the fine texture the raking light paid for) and sharpening in moderation, because over-sharpened pattern shots shimmer. Where one frame's resolution runs out, stitching several from a stable hover into a panorama is legitimate craft, and bracketed merges for high-range scenes are the same honesty: assembling what the camera genuinely recorded, not inventing what it didn't.
And the honest truth, which in this genre is written in the sky: post cannot rescue the light. No amount of contrast manufactures the relief that a low sun would have carved and a midday flight didn't; dehaze recovers a veiled scene, not a flat one: shadow that was never cast cannot be dialed in. And no edit reopens the flight window: the battery that ran out two minutes before the light peaked, the wind that grounded the evening flight, the haze that never lifted (those frames were decided in the air or never existed at all). The light and the flight window are capture-limited. Editing polishes what the flight brought home; it cannot go back up.

For aerial frames in the 6–7 band, the bottleneck is most often composition or light: the frame is a high snapshot (altitude standing in for a subject, a view that proves the aircraft went up without finding the pattern, line, or anchor that organizes it) or it was flown under a flat high sun, so the terrain reads as a shadowless map with nothing for the eye to hold. At 8 and above, the bottlenecks shift to fine margins: a horizon a half-degree off level, haze handled too timidly or too hard, clipped sparkle on sunlit water, shadows lifted past what the small sensor's file could give cleanly.
- Name the frame's organizing idea in one phrase (a pattern, a line, a scale anchor, a shadow) and if the honest answer is "the view from up there," the composition isn't finished.
- Check the horizon against the frame edge, if there is one.
- Zoom to 100% in the shadows and the fine texture: is the detail clean, or is the file already showing the push?
- The harder question, the one that decides the band: do the shadows in the frame have length and direction (was this flown in light that shaped the ground, or in light that merely lit it)?

The 6 is correct, and correctness is its ceiling. The exposure holds, the horizon is roughly level, the view is genuinely elevated and momentarily impressive the way any view from altitude is. But the frame is organized by nothing: it is coverage, the landscape recorded from above rather than composed from above, with no pattern isolated, no line leading, no anchor giving the vastness a size. The light is whenever-light: high, shadowless, the terrain flattened into a colored map. The novelty of altitude is doing all the work, and novelty is the one element of a photograph that evaporates on the second look. The diagnostic tell: the frame answers "what does this place look like from above", and no other question.
An 8 is a photograph that happens to have been made in the air. The view is committed: a clean nadir abstraction or a purposeful oblique, not a hedge between them. The frame is built on a graphic idea that only altitude could see: the rhythm of the field lines, the one red roof in a grid of grey ones, the boat and its wake cutting a dark harbor, the shadows of the trees laid longer than the trees. The light is chosen light (low, raking, giving the surface relief and the shadows a direction) and the file is clean because the flight was flown when the light was worth the battery. Scale is handled on purpose: anchored and immediate, or abandoned entirely for abstraction. The 6 shows that the photographer's camera got up there. The 8 shows what the place is from up there, and that difference is decided before takeoff, in the sun angle the flight was planned around and the idea the frame was built on.

Aerial is the genre most completely at the mercy of a coincidence: the light, the weather, and the flight window all have to open at once, over ground that actually organizes from above, and some evenings the wind grounds the aircraft at golden hour, some mornings the haze never lifts, and some locations simply hold no pattern at altitude, however precisely they are flown. Sometimes the repeat is naming the site or the season, not the technique: the field that is a checkerboard at harvest is a grey blank in March. Read it as a description of what the sky and the ground offered that flight, then plan the next one, because the light that didn't come today is on tomorrow's forecast, and the battery charges overnight.
